Trained and mentored junior developers and engineers, teaching skills in Platform led Development and working to improve overall team performance.
Collaborated with cross-functional teams to design innovative software solutions.
Contributed valuable insights during product refining sessions, aligning technical strategy with business objectives.
Worked with QA and BA teams to correct problems and run test scenarios.
Software Engineer
CTS
08.2016 - 05.2021
Project- OptimaIntake Implementation for HartFord
Interact with client/ end user (Business Analysts) and understanding the business requirements.
Application end-to-end Development, along with adding customized features to product, using Microservices, Hibernate & Spring Integration techniques.
Mentoring new joinees in team.
Maintained existing software systems by identifying and correcting software defects.
Updated old code bases to modern development standards, improving functionality.
Developed reusable components that significantly reduced development effort on multiple projects.
Developed robust, scalable, modular and API-centric infrastructures.
Provided technical guidance to junior developers, fostering a positive team environment and promoting professional growth.
Worked with Business development and Testing team members to design and develop robust solutions to meet client requirements for functionality, scalability, and performance
Programmer Analyst
CTS
12.2017 - 12.2019
Project-Life Admin Core
Interact with the client/ end user (Business Analysts) and understanding the business requirements.
Report Creation using ETL Techniques (ODI) required for external systems.
Data Analytics- Data Hub Creation for the entire system, understanding the processes and flow involved.
Report Generation on real time basis, using Apache Camel- spring Integration with Mongodb.
Programmer Analyst Trainee
Cognizant Technology Solutions
12.2016 - 12.2017
Project: Anthem Health Insurance Provider-Application
Involved in front-end and back-end development activities.
Test Driven Development- through J-Units.
Adapted to changing project requirements, efficiently refactoring code to meet new specifications without compromising functionality or performance.